- 締切済み
条件付き書式以外で条件を付けたい!
jindonの回答
- jindon
- ベストアンサー率43% (50/116)
jindonです >プルダウンから苗字を選択して入力していたので いまいち状況が見えません。 入力規則のプルダウンですか? そのリストの中に (1)田中 (2)田中 (3)田中 . . (6)中村 等あって、それから選択するのでしたら、 change イベントが認知するはずですが?
関連するQ&A
- エクセルのセル文字列末尾だけを削除する方法ありますか?
こんにちは。 エクセルで各セルに ------------------------ 山田さん 鈴木 田中さん 木村さんと川村さん ------------------------ のような最後に”さん”がついている場合とついていない場合があります。 ”さん”を置換して空白にすれば削除できるのですが、 木村さんと川村さん のセルの”木村さん”の”さん”は削除せず、セルの文字列末尾の”川村さん”の”さん”は削除したいのです。 希望としては、 ------------------------ 山田 鈴木 田中 木村さんと川村 ------------------------ の様な形にしたいのですが、何か良い方法ありましたらアドバイス頂けませんでしょうか? よろしくお願いいたします。
- ベストアンサー
- オフィス系ソフト
- 条件を抽出し、フラグを立てる関数
下記条件の場合、D列に「○」フラグを立てたいです。 D列に入力する関数を教えてください。 どうぞよろしくお願い致します。 ・ B列が同じ名前の行を抽出。 ・ 抽出した行のC列に「鉛筆」「消しゴム」「ペン」が入力されている場合、 D列に「○」をつけたい。 ・ ただし、B列が同じでも、C列に「鉛筆」「消しゴム」「ペン」以外が入っていた 場合、D列には何も入れない。 ※B列には飛び飛びに同じ名前が入力されている場合もあります。 ※行は1000行ほどあります。 【前】 B列 C列 山田太郎 鉛筆 山田太郎 ペン 伊藤二郎 缶 伊藤二郎 鉛筆 鈴木五郎 ペン 鈴木五郎 消しゴム 木村三郎 消しゴム 木村三郎 鉛筆 山田太郎 消しゴム 鈴木五郎 パソコン 【後】 B列 C列 D列 山田太郎 鉛筆 ○ 山田太郎 ペン ○ 伊藤二郎 缶 伊藤二郎 鉛筆 鈴木五郎 ペン 鈴木五郎 消しゴム 木村三郎 消しゴム ○ 木村三郎 鉛筆 ○ 山田太郎 消しゴム ○ 鈴木五郎 パソコン わかりにくくて申し訳ありませんが、よろしくお願いいたします。
- 締切済み
- その他MS Office製品
- 条件付き書式で別シートから参照させたい
エクセルの条件付き書式について質問です。 Sheet1のデータを検索して別シートに結果を引っ張っています。 検索結果が男は”青”、女は”赤”、空欄は”灰”というパターンでセルの色が 変わるようにしたいのです。エクセルの本やネット検索で1つの答えを出しましたが、 「式が正しくありません」とエラーが出ます。どこが間違ってるのかわかりません。 どなたか教えていただければ助かります。宜しくお願い致します。 【Sheet1】 【Sheet2】 A B C A 1 山田太郎 男 1 山田太郎 ←青 2 田中花子 女 2 田中花子 ←赤 3 女 3 ←灰 4 鈴木二郎 男 4 鈴木二郎 ←青 Sheet2のA列には、=IF(Sheet1!$A1="","",Sheet1!$A1) Sheet2での条件付き書式で、 条件1 =COUNT(IF(INDIRECT("Sheet1!$A$1:$A$100")=A1,IF(INDIRECT("Sheet1!$C$1:$C$100")="男",))) 書式:青 条件2は"女"で赤となります。
- ベストアンサー
- オフィス系ソフト
- excelの条件付き書式でこれをやりたい!!!
すみません、助けてください。 Excelの条件付き書式で(マクロとかではなくて条件付き書式で)やりたいことがありますが、 成功しません。お知恵を借りたいので、どうぞよろしくお願いします。 図の B7:B10 のように、西崎、田中、鈴木、木村 という人の名前が入っています。 B13:C17に、営業部は誰と誰、人事部は誰と誰、女性は誰と誰…というように、所属人員表があります。 お気づきのように、営業部の西崎は営業部の区分にも名前があり、女性なので女性の区分にも入っています。 やりたいことは、 B3に営業部という区分を入力したとき、B13:C17の所属人員表によれば営業部なので西崎と鈴木が該当。B7:B10にあるリスト中の該当者は、条件付き書式で塗りつぶしがかかる。。。 女性という区分を入力したのなら、それに該当する西崎,鈴木木村,に塗りつぶしがか。。。 ということをやりたいのです。 (B3は、入力規則を使ってリスト選択できるようにしようと思っています) 条件付き書式を「数式で」にし、関数などを駆使してこれを実現したいのですが、 うまくできません。 条件付き書式内で、下記のような数式を書いてみました。 =$B7=VLOOKUP($B$3,$B$14:$C$17,2) こうすると、B13:C17の所属人員表において、所属人員が1名ならば成功します。 しかし、ここでは複数人いるため、ワイルドカード「*」を使えないか?と思ってみましたが、 =*$B7*=VLOOKUP($B$3,$B$14:$C$17,2) ="*"&$B7&"*"=VLOOKUP($B$3,$B$14:$C$17,2) =("*"&$B7&"*")=VLOOKUP($B$3,$B$14:$C$17,2) こんな風に書いてみても、うまくいっていません。 VLOOKUPにこだわらないので、ほかの関数でできるとか、 所属人員を1セルにカンマ区切りで全員書くのではなく、右方向(D列やE列)に一名ずつセルを分けて書いてもいいです。 どうにか成功する知恵を授けてください。 よろしくお願いします…
- ベストアンサー
- 財務・会計・経理
- 条件付き書式について
条件付き書式について A B C 件数 売上商品名 売上日 0 リンゴ 1/1 4 リンゴ 1/2 3 リンゴ 1/3 0 リンゴ 1/4 上記のような表をエクセル2003で作成しました。 A列の3行目と6行目の0件は誤入力です。 そこで質問なのですが、Bにリンゴの入力があり、かつ、 A列に0が入っていれば、セルを黄色にする条件付き書式 設定をしたいのですが、やり方がよくわかりませんでした。 教えてください。 あと、できればVBAで出来る方法も教えていただければ幸いです。
- ベストアンサー
- オフィス系ソフト
- エクセルで2つの条件を元に
エクセル2007で名簿を作っています。 1ヶ月ごとにメンバーの順が変わります。 シート1(番号順に名簿を作りました) A B C 1 1 山田 2 2 木村 3 3 副長 佐藤 4 4 鈴木 5 5 班長 田中 6 6 長田 シート2(こちらがメンバーに配る名簿です) A B C D 1 班長 1 3 2 田中 山田 鈴木 3 4 副長 2 4 5 佐藤 木村 長田 A2に田中,A5に佐藤を選んでくるのはvlookupで成功しました。 質問したいのは C列D列に上記の番号のようにシート1の名前を入れていきたいのですが,田中,佐藤の分を抜いた上で番号の若い順に選んできたいのです。 どのような関数をどのように使えば成功するでしょうか。
- ベストアンサー
- その他MS Office製品
- エクセルの条件付き書式が消えてしまいます。
エクセルの条件付き書式が消えてしまいます。 エクセルのC列に条件付き書式を設定ました。次の数式のとき、セルに色がつくというものです。 =COUNTIF(C:C,C1)>1 しかし、行を削除したり、また付け加えたりしているうちに、条件付き書式が無効になるのに気づきました。おそらく新しく追加する行にはこれは無効なのでしょうか。。(?) 私はC列ならすべて、この条件に当てはめたかったのですが、追加したり削除したりしていると、無効になるセル(行)が発生するようです。 これを防ぐことはできないでしょうか?条件付き書式ではムリで、マクロなどにするしかないのでしょうか?
- ベストアンサー
- オフィス系ソフト
- Excelの条件付き書式の書式の適用先について
Excelの「条件付き書式」についての質問です。 「条件付き書式」⇒「新しいルール」⇒「数式を利用して,書式設定するセルを決定」 数式の中に「B$2 = 1」 と入力して 適用先に「$B$2:$H$5」と入力しました。 その時に,2行目で「1」がある列の書式が5行目まで変わりました。 また 数式の中に「$B2 = 1」 と入力して 適用先に「$B$2:$H$5」と入力しました。 その時に,2行目で「1」がある列の書式が5行目まで変わりました。 その時,B列で「1」がある行のがH列まで変わりました。 条件付き書式の行全体・列全体が変わる理由はなぜでしょうか?
- 締切済み
- Excel(エクセル)
- 条件付書式 二者択一で適用
エクセル2002を使っています。 画像の様な条件付書式で、木村 と同時に 鈴木を検索するにはどうしたらよいでしょうか? よろしくお願いします。
- ベストアンサー
- オフィス系ソフト
補足
jindonさん 返信が大変遅くなり、すみません!! 言葉足らずでしたので、補足します。 状況が少し複雑なのですが、下記の名前は同じシート内に別に作った表からアルファべットを選択して埋めているのです。 ※1 表1の列Aが入力規則のプルダウンで選択できるようになっている。 ※2 列B,C,Dには関数(=IF(A1="","",VLOOKUP(A1,$E$1:$H$37,2,FALSE)))が入っていて、列Aのプルダウンからアルファベットを選択すると、表2の該当するアルファベットの行がそのまま表1の列B,C,Dに値が入る。 ■表1(シフト表) 列A 列B 列C 列D 行1 A1 (1)田中 (2)鈴木 (3)山田 行2 B1 (2)石田 (3)西山 - 行3 C1 (3)木村 (4)中山 - 行4 D1 (4)川村 (1)鈴木 (2)田中(良) --------------------------------------------- ■表2(シフト表をプルダウンで選択する為の表) 列E 列F 列G 列H 行1 A1 (1)田中 (2)鈴木 (3)山田 行2 B1 (2)石田 (3)西山 - 行3 C1 (3)木村 (4)中山 - 行4 D1 (4)川村 (1)鈴木 (2)田中(良) ・ ・ ・ 問題は表1の列Aで選択した時に、列B,C,Dの値にすぐ色が反映される訳ではなく、一度B~Dの任意のセルを編集状態にし、Enterキーを押すと色がつくということです。 分かりづらいのですが、何卒ご教授願います!